Initiative Boosts Female Participation in Nigeria’s Tech Sector

The Girls Tech Boot Camp is training over 300 secondary school girls across Nigeria in AI, Data Science, and Python. Organized by the Girls Techies Humanitarian Initiative and funded by the NeurIPS Foundation, the five-day program runs across all six geopolitical zones.

The initiative aims to bridge the gender gap in technology by giving students early STEM exposure and hands-on coding skills, supported by ongoing school tech clubs.

Early Technical Education and Skill Development

Program leaders emphasize that early exposure helps girls build confidence and compete in technical fields. Participants learn practical applications to prepare for future careers in software engineering and digital technology.
